How much does it cost to rent an apartment in Beaumont?
Bedroom | Average Rent | Cheapest Rent | Highest Rent |
---|---|---|---|
Beaumont Studio Apartments | $1,069 | $730 | $1,408 |
Beaumont 1 Bedroom Apartments | $991 | $550 | $2,262 |
Beaumont 2 Bedroom Apartments | $1,205 | $250 | $2,931 |
Beaumont 3 Bedroom Apartments | $1,424 | $250 | $3,834 |
Beaumont 4 Bedroom Apartments | $1,418 | $250 | $1,695 |

Frequently Asked Questions about Beaumont
What is the current price range for One Bedroom Beaumont Apartments for rent?
Today's rental pricing for One Bedroom Apartments in Beaumont ranges from $550 to $2,262 with an average monthly rent of $991.
What does renting a Two Bedroom Apartment in Beaumont cost?
The monthly rent prices of Two Bedroom Apartments currently available in Beaumont range from $250 to $2,931. Today's average rental price for Two Bedrooms here is $1,205.
How expensive are Beaumont Three Bedroom Apartments?
There are currently 42 Three Bedroom Apartments listings available in Beaumont on ApartmentHomeLiving.com. The pricing ranges from $250 to $3,834 - averaging $1,424 for the location.
